View Poll Results: In which e-book formats do you have books that you'd still like to be able to read?
eReader 41 38.32%
Mobipocket 51 47.66%
Sony's BBeB (LRX) 30 28.04%
Kindle (AZW) 7 6.54%
MS Reader (LIT) 48 44.86%
Bookwise (IMP) 11 10.28%
Isilo (IS/PDB) 10 9.35%
Plucker 3 2.80%
RocketBook (RB) 6 5.61%
Franklin (FUB) 0 0%
Hiebook (KML) 0 0%
Other (please specify below) 6 5.61%
Since you're going to ask for it: open/non-dedicated ebook formats such as PDF, HTML, TXT, RTF, etc. 68 63.55%
I've never bought any e-books in an encrypted format 8 7.48%
I'd just like to see the results 5 4.67%
Multiple Choice Poll. Voters: 107. You may not vote on this poll
